comparison vimrc @ 193:0c8211e1c67a

Update look of tmux
author zegervdv <zegervdv@me.com>
date Tue, 11 Nov 2014 17:18:32 +0100
parents 4a74a83e6e36
children f51c1b5e0891
comparison
equal deleted inserted replaced
192:6df73555c3a7 193:0c8211e1c67a
96 set wrapmargin=2 96 set wrapmargin=2
97 set linebreak 97 set linebreak
98 set breakindent 98 set breakindent
99 set lbr 99 set lbr
100 set tabstop=2 shiftwidth=2 100 set tabstop=2 shiftwidth=2
101
102 " Layout
103 set t_Co=256
101 set background=dark 104 set background=dark
102 color Tomorrow-Night 105 color Tomorrow-Night
103 set guifont=Inconsolata\ for\ Powerline:h12 106 set guifont=Inconsolata\ for\ Powerline:h12
107 " Make background color same as terminal ("transparent")
108 " hi Normal ctermbg=none
109
104 set autowrite 110 set autowrite
105 set hidden 111 set hidden
106 set hlsearch 112 set hlsearch
107 set incsearch 113 set incsearch
108 set ignorecase 114 set ignorecase
350 nmap ++ vip++ 356 nmap ++ vip++
351 " }}} 357 " }}}
352 " Airline configuration {{{ 358 " Airline configuration {{{
353 let g:airline_inactive_collapse=0 359 let g:airline_inactive_collapse=0
354 let g:airline_powerline_fonts=1 360 let g:airline_powerline_fonts=1
361 let g:airline#extensions#tmuxline#enabled = 0
355 362
356 let g:airline_left_sep = '' 363 let g:airline_left_sep = ''
357 let g:airline_right_sep = '' 364 let g:airline_right_sep = ''
358 365
359 if has("gui_running") 366 if has("gui_running")
548 autocmd FileType c nnoremap <buffer> <silent><leader>s :w<CR>:VimuxRunCommand('make')<CR> 555 autocmd FileType c nnoremap <buffer> <silent><leader>s :w<CR>:VimuxRunCommand('make')<CR>
549 " }}} 556 " }}}
550 " Tmuxline {{{ 557 " Tmuxline {{{
551 let g:tmuxline_powerline_separators=0 558 let g:tmuxline_powerline_separators=0
552 let g:tmuxline_preset = { 559 let g:tmuxline_preset = {
553 \ 'a': '#S', 560 \ 'a': '',
554 \ 'b': '#F', 561 \ 'b': '',
555 \ 'c': '#W', 562 \ 'c': '',
556 \ 'win': ['#I', '#W'], 563 \ 'win': ['#I', '#W'],
557 \ 'cwin': ['#I', '#W'], 564 \ 'cwin': ['#I', '#W'],
558 \ 'y': ['%a %b %d', '%R'], 565 \ 'y': '',
559 \ 'z': '#h'} 566 \ 'z': ''}
567 let g:tmuxline_theme = {
568 \ 'a' : [250, 109],
569 \ 'b': [250, 239],
570 \ 'c': [250, 235],
571 \ 'win': [241, 235],
572 \ 'cwin': [250, 235],
573 \ 'x' : [250, 235],
574 \ 'y': [250, 235],
575 \ 'z': [250, 235],
576 \ 'bg' : [250, 235],
577 \ }
560 " }}} 578 " }}}
561 " After-objects {{{ 579 " After-objects {{{
562 autocmd VimEnter * call after_object#enable('=', ':', '-', '#', ' ') 580 autocmd VimEnter * call after_object#enable('=', ':', '-', '#', ' ')
563 " }}} 581 " }}}
564 " Vim-tmux-navigator {{{ 582 " Vim-tmux-navigator {{{